    Maha Guru SGMD was a private student of the legendary escrimador Angel Cabales. Maha Guru talks about how he met Angel and talks about their close family type relationship they shared for many years and the future of Serrada Escrima.

    I welcome New York Times best selling author Steven Barnes to the show. Aside from being an accomplished writer Steven is an equally accomplished martial artist. Steven talks about his time at the Inosanto Academy in the early days of it's existence, him being a student of who Bruce Lee called "The fastest hands in the business" Sijo Steve Muhammad, as well as his friendship with the late great Pendekar Maha Guru Cliff Stewart.
